My printer keeps flashing orange light with E4. I've taken it apart no paper stuck anywhere. I've cleaned everything. Tried to reset . Nothing works. How can I get the light to go off. I've unplugged it. Nothing.

The E4 error on HP Smart Tank printers typically means a paper jam or a carriage jam, even if you don’t see any paper stuck. It can also indicate a sensor or carriage alignment issue.
What E4 Means
- Paper jam detected (including tiny scraps in the rollers).
- Carriage jam (printhead carrier stuck or sensor misread).
- Sometimes triggered by encoder strip contamination or mechanical obstruction.
Step 1: Power Reset
- With the printer ON, unplug the power cord from the back and the wall.
- Wait 60 seconds.
- Plug it back directly into a wall outlet (avoid surge protectors).
- Turn the printer back on.
Step 2: Check Carriage Movement
- Open the ink access door.
- Does the printhead carriage move freely to the center?
- If not, gently move it side to side (with power off).
- Remove any packing material or debris.
Step 3: Inspect Encoder Strip
- The thin transparent strip behind the carriage can get dirty.
- Clean gently with a lint-free cloth dampened with distilled water.
Step 4: Check Paper Path
- Remove the rear access door and inspect the rollers.
- Use a flashlight to check for tiny scraps of paper.
Step 5: Reset Printer
- Press and hold Cancel + Wireless buttons for 5 seconds to reset.
